**Meeting notes — Tuesday sync, Glimmerpoint Ops**

- Intermittent DNS failures on the Harrowfield cluster confirmed; resolver cache expiring too aggressively.
- Support: advise affected customers to retry; no client-side fix needed.
- Temporary mitigation deployed; permanent resolver config change scheduled this week.
- Escalate any new reports with timestamps attached.
- Ongoing ownership of this issue sits with the engineer named below.

account owner for bawip-tahag: Raleth Quenok

**Action item (SEV-3, Clockvine calendar sync)**

Duplicate-event conflicts occurred when Clockvine's two-way sync retried a timed-out write. Fix: make event creation idempotent via client-generated keys. Until deployed, support should dedupe manually using the reconciliation script rather than deleting events by hand — deletes re-propagate. Owner: platform team, due next sprint. The interim dedupe procedure for support is documented on the page below.

wiki page, tahaf-tajog: https://jira.ordindyn.corp/pipeline

Quick primer on Stormrelay, our weather-alert fan-out. When Nimbuscore flags a severe-weather event, Stormrelay pushes notifications to every subscribed channel within two seconds — that latency budget is the one metric releases must never regress. Before cutting a release, run the fan-out smoke test against the staging broker and check the delivery report. The smoke test authenticates against the internal Stormrelay admin service using the key that follows.

API key for yahig-tadup: kto7_ubizbYm

## Runbook: LargeDiff Viewer (Project Spanwick)

When diffing files above 200 MB, the viewer shells out to the chunked comparator rather than loading both sides into memory. Future maintainers should note that chunk size is tuned per deployment and must not be changed without re-running the Spanwick benchmark suite. The comparator authenticates against the artifact cache before fetching baseline blobs, and that handshake requires a credential in the service env file. Add the following line to enable cache access:

secret setting of yajog-taguf: ARCHIVE_KEY3=051